#include <bits/stdc++.h>

using namespace std;

set<int> ans;

void calc(int n, int stop, int sum) {
	ans.insert(sum + n - 1);
	for (int i = stop; i <= n/i; ++i)
		if (n % i == 0)
			calc(n/i, i, sum + i - 1);
}

int main() {
	int n;
	scanf("%d", &n);

	calc(n, 2, 0);

	printf("%d\n", (int)ans.size());
	for (int x: ans)
		printf("%d ", x);
	printf("\n");
}
